Summary
The Business Analyst role at MAS offers the opportunity to work at the center of strategy, performance, and product transformation. The position supports leadership by driving KPI development, strategic planning, reporting, budgeting, and project governance, ensuring seamless execution of departmental goals. With a focus on data-driven insights, structured coordination, and cross-functional collaboration, the role is ideal for analytical thinkers who thrive in dynamic, innovation-led environments. The successful candidate will contribute to long-range planning, monitor key initiatives, and support decision-making while maintaining operational efficiency and strong stakeholder communication.

Frequently Asked Questions
1. What qualifications are required for this role?
A bachelor’s degree in Business, Finance, Project Management, or a related field is required.
2. How much experience is needed?
Candidates should have one to two years of experience in a corporate or project-driven environment.
3. Does the role involve strategic planning?
Yes, the role contributes to KPI development, long-range planning, budgeting, and departmental strategy.
4. What skills are essential to succeed?
Strong analytical ability, communication skills, project management capability, and proficiency in MS Office.
